@charset "utf-8";
/* CSS Document */

body { margin-left: 0px; margin-top: 5px; margin-right: 0px; margin-bottom: 5px; text-align: center; background-color: #333; text-align: center;}

body,td,th { font-family: Verdana, Geneva, sans-serif; font-size:12px; color: #660033;	}

h1 {font-size: 14px; }
h2 {font-size: 12px; }
img {border: 0px;}
a { color:#660033; }
a:hover { color:#660033; text-decoration: none;}

#container { margin: 0px auto; width: 796px; text-align: left; }

#header { background: url(/images/bg_tiler2.png) repeat-x; }
#headerLC { float:left; width: 105px; height: 133px; background: url(/images/lay_t_l_corner2.jpg) no-repeat top left; }
#logo { float:left; width: 257px; height: 133px; }
#theguys { float:left; width: 72px; height: 133px; }
#headerRC { float:right; width: 28px; height: 133px; background: url(/images/lay_t_r_corner2.jpg) no-repeat top right; }
#navTiler { float:right; width: 330px; height: 133px; background: url(/images/nav_tiler2.png) repeat-x bottom left; }
#navLeft { float:left; width: 11px; height: 133px; background: url(/images/nav_left2.png) no-repeat bottom left; }

#contactForm { color: #333; float:left; width: 319px; height: 60px; margin-top: 64px; text-align: center;}
#contactForm a { color: #333; text-decoration: none;}
#contactForm a:hover { color: #333; text-decoration: underline;}

#contentContainer { border-left: 2px solid #f14d83; border-right: 2px solid #f14d83; background: #fadfe8 ; }
#contentContainerHome { border-left: 2px solid #f14d83; border-right: 2px solid #f14d83; background: #fadfe8 url(/images/lay_photo.jpg) no-repeat bottom right ; }
#contentL { float:left; width: 430px; margin-top: 10px; padding-left: 10px; }
#contentR { float:right; width: 340px;}
#contentWide { float:left; width: 770px; margin-top: 10px; padding-left: 10px; }
.clsContentPrice { margin-right: 10px; padding-left: 10px; padding-top: 5px; padding-right: 10px; margin-top: 10px;}
.clsContentPhotos { margin-right: 10px; padding-left: 10px; padding-top: 5px; padding-right: 10px;padding-bottom: 10px; margin-top: 10px;}

.collapse { background: transparent url(/images/collapser/collapse.gif) no-repeat scroll 0% 0%; height: 11px; position: relative;    width: 11px; cursor: pointer; margin-top: -22px;}
.expand { background:transparent url(/images/collapser/expand.gif) no-repeat scroll 0% 0%; display:none; height:11px; position:relative; width:11px; cursor: pointer; margin-top: -22px;}
.pink { background: #fadfe8; border: 1px solid #f14d83; padding: 5px; }
.people legend { font-size: 14px; font-style: italic; font-weight: bold; padding: 5px; margin-left:10px; line-height: 14px; background-color: #fadfe8; border: 1px solid #fadfe8; }

fieldset { background: #fadfe8; border: 1px solid #fadfe8; border: 0px solid #fadfe8; }

#urchindesigns { float: right; padding: 5px; padding-right: 30px; color: #fadfe8; }
#urchindesigns a { color: #fadfe8; }
#urchindesigns a:hover { color: #fadfe8; text-decoration: none;}

#submit { color: #f14d83; background: #fcacc7; border: 1px ridge #f14d83; width: 50%; }
input, textarea { border: 1px solid #f14d83; width: 90%; }
#code { width: 50%; }
.ccxcx { overflow: hidden; }

span.skype_pnh_container {display:none !important;}
span.skype_pnh_print_container {display:inline !important;}

.clear { clear:both; height:0px; font-size: 1px; line-height: 0px; }
